It never hurts to remove and re-seat the HDMI cable connection, or even try a different HDMI cable. There could be a problem with the HDMI cable plugs, or the HDMI receptacle on the receiver. There are 19 connector pins in a single HDMI connector, and they are tiny.

As for the "unknown disc" error, perhaps you have a little dust accumulation on the player's laser lens.
